学习ROS前,需要知道Linux的哪些知识
涉及到的东西很多,理论上的包括linux理念自由软件思想还有这个圈子的文化等等、
技术上呢,多动手操练操练,尤其是命令,先了解命令的作用是什么,然后在终端中输入命令,看看会是什么效果。。。其实有些命令看看名字就知道干什么的了,像cp、mv、grep、ls,不懂的看手册用man命令,另外多用google
至于shell,哪有多难的,脚本语言嘛,自己写写脚本运行一下就会了的,,,
学习这些东西更多的应该是完全的无理由的去接受,因为这些就是rules,是人们给定下来的规矩,cp就是用来复制文件的,不要问为什么用cp这个命令来复制文件,没意义的。。。。
你不懂这些命令就是怎么不懂的,比如mkdir创建目录这个命令用它就能够创建一个文件夹有不明白的吗
难道说你看不懂那些描述命令作用的句子?如果那些句子都看不懂就像我前面说的那样动手做啊。
使用便宜的台式机,配合免费的Linux软件,软路由弹性较大,而且台式机处理器性能强大,所以处理效能不错,也较容易扩充。但对应地也要求技术人员需掌握更多的例如设置方法、参数设计等专业知识,同时设定也比较复杂,而且需技术人员具备一定应变技术能力。
同时台式机的硬件配置如果选择不好或不合理,而且担任路由器的功能如果长期工作,故障的几率将很高。用一台台式机搭建,成本并不低,但是如果要使用服务器,成本则更高,技术人员学习的过程亦较为繁琐。
ros软路由性能稳定:
常见的硬件宽带路由器,绝大部分都是用软件来实现的,跟软件路由器是一样的,而且软件路由器一般硬件配置要比硬件的宽带路由器配置高,所以某些情况下速度比几千上万元的硬件路由器稳定还要快。
至于软件路由器的稳定性,受益于稳定的Linux和BSD内核,软件路由器的稳定性非常好,见过最长时间不用重启的软件路由器,已经有一年多了。
以上内容参考?百度百科-ros软路由
以上内容参考?百度百科-软路由
鹏仔微信 15129739599 鹏仔QQ344225443 鹏仔前端 pjxi.com 共享博客 sharedbk.com
图片声明:本站部分配图来自网络。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!